PassportCard is part of the Davidshield Group, an international travel insurance and private medical insurance focusing on markets in Germany, Australia and Israel. [1] [2] [3] Customers insured with PassportCard use a prepaid card to pay health service providers, eliminating the need to submit invoices or pay deductibles. [4]

Small numbers of persons are covered by tax-funded government employee insurance or by social welfare insurance. Private supplementary insurance to the sickness funds of various sorts is available. It adds coverage for extras such as eyeglasses and dental care. In 2005, Germany spent 10.7% of GDP on health care, or US$3,628 per capita.
Since 2009, health insurance has been compulsory for the whole population in Germany, when coverage was expanded from the majority of the population to everyone. Travel insurance is an insurance product for covering unexpected losses incurred while travelling, either internationally or domestically.
